Primary antennas for transmitting wireless telephone service, including cellular and personal communications service (PCS), are usually located outdoors on towers and other elevated structures like rooftops, water tanks and sides of buildings. 1410 recommendations, base station antenna heights typically range between 15-60 meters. Urban deployments favor 25-35m, rural coverage requires 40-55m, while 5G mmWave systems operate efficiently at 15-25m. Then we have guyed towers in figure 4 below.

    Analysis of 5G base station cost breakdown in China: component-level estimates for BBU/AAU, power/auxiliaries and civil works, with a ~450,000 yuan total estimate. China's total 5G network investment for 2020-2025 is estimated at 0. 5 trillion yuan, with a large portion allocated to base stations. This article summarizes the main cost components of a 5G macro base station and provides a rough cost breakdown. Because China's operators are state-owned. I want to know the roughly price of the 5G base station, we can simply calculate through China Mobile 2020 5G equipment procurement program: This purchase 5G base station is 232,000, the total purchase is 100 million yuan, and the cost of each 5G base station is 16 10,000 yuan.
